Avatar billede c-sharp Nybegynder
15. marts 2004 - 13:30 Der er 8 kommentarer og
1 løsning

Ekspotere data fra AS400 til MS SQL-server med XML

Jeg skal have en mulighed for at ligge data fra AS400 til en SQL-server, derfor havde jeg overvejet at trække alle data ud af AS400 i XML og ved hjælp af en lille applikation ligge disse i SQL-serveren. Men hvordan laver jeg et XML-dokument?

Jeg har i min SQL-database 3 tabeller, min plan var at udtække data i et XML-dokument som indeholder disse 3 tabeller, men er det den rigtige måde at gøre det på?

Eks.

  <?xml version="1.0" encoding="ISO-8859-1" ?>
  <GRUPPER>
    <GRUPPE>
      <GRUPPENR>13</GRUPPENR>
      <OVERGRUPPENR>1</OVERGRUPPENR>
      <SPROGID>4</SPROGID>
    </GRUPPE>
  </GRUPPER>

Er det måden at have flere tabeller i en XML fil, eller hvad?
  <VARERE>
    <VARE>
      <VARENR>13</VARENR>
      <GRUPPENR>1</GRUPPENR>
      <TEKSTSPROGID>4</TEKSTSPROGID>
      <BESKRIVELSESPROGID>4</BESKRIVELSESPROGID>
      <BILLEDE>4</BILLEDE>
      <TEGNING>4</TEGNING>
    </VARE>
  </VARERE>

  <TEKSTER>
    <SPROG>
      <SPROGID>13</SPROGID>
      <SPROG>1</SPROG>
      <TEKST>4</TEKST>
    </SPROG>
  </TEKSTER>
Avatar billede nute Nybegynder
15. marts 2004 - 13:45 #1
"Men hvordan laver jeg et XML-dokument?" - ehh ... du har lige lavet 3 XML "dokumenter" ... hvorfor spørger du så om hvordan det laves ?

"men er det den rigtige måde at gøre det på" - det er ingenting der er "rigtigt" eller "forkert" med tanke på XML. Der er noget der er bedre at gøre end andet, men definitivt ikke noget "right or wrong". Det gode med XML at du selv bestemmer hvordan formatet skal være.

/nute
Avatar billede c-sharp Nybegynder
15. marts 2004 - 13:51 #2
Nu skriver du at jeg lige har lavet 3 XML dokumenter, men kan disse godt ligge i samme fil?
Avatar billede nute Nybegynder
15. marts 2004 - 14:05 #3
nope ... det kan de ikke.
Avatar billede c-sharp Nybegynder
15. marts 2004 - 14:12 #4
Det vil sige at man ikke kan have flere "Tabeller" i et XML dokument, eller er der en anden måde at skrive det på?
Avatar billede nute Nybegynder
15. marts 2004 - 14:20 #5
selvfølgelig kan man have flere "tabeller" i et xml dokument - læs hvad jeg skriver i mit første indlæg:

"men er det den rigtige måde at gøre det på" - det er ingenting der er "rigtigt" eller "forkert" med tanke på XML. Der er noget der er bedre at gøre end andet, men definitivt ikke noget "right or wrong". Det gode med XML at du selv bestemmer hvordan formatet skal være.

/nute
Avatar billede c-sharp Nybegynder
19. marts 2004 - 08:59 #6
nute>> smid et svar så er der point!
Avatar billede nute Nybegynder
19. marts 2004 - 09:28 #7
svar
Avatar billede c-sharp Nybegynder
19. marts 2004 - 11:01 #8
Tak for hjælpen
Avatar billede nute Nybegynder
19. marts 2004 - 11:34 #9
ehh ... selv tak ... :| ved ikke helt hvad jeg hjalp med, men men :o]
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ester